ISU Cabagan's ROTC Program: Empowering Future Leaders
The Reserve Officers' Training Corps (ROTC) program at Isabela State University (ISU) Cabagan is dedicated to shaping the next generation of leaders by fostering a culture of excellence, discipline, and service. With a strong emphasis on developing the whole individual, our program aims to produce future-ready student leaders who embody the values of honor, duty, and country.

# Benefits of Joining the ROTC Program
1. Scholarship Opportunities:
Our program offers scholarship opportunities to deserving cadets, helping to support their academic pursuits.
2. Leadership Skills:
Cadets develop valuable leadership skills, including communication, problem-solving, and decision-making.
3. Networking Opportunities:
Our program provides opportunities for cadets to connect with like-minded individuals and build relationships with military and civilian leaders.
